Otherwise, the evening of the match remained calm from the point of view of the police. State police said on Wednesday that there was no significant incident.
Sturm Graz were defeated 3–1 by PSV Eindhoven in the second leg. In the first leg itself, Christian Ilzer’s team clearly lost 4–1. The miracle didn’t happen on Tuesday. “The 7:2 speaks a clear language and shows that this absolute top level is lacking a bit,” said coach Christian Ilzer, whose sober assessment was also mixed with optimism.
